The Police Announce Final Show

By Paul Cashmere
Sat, 07 Jun 2008 07:39:09 +1000

The Police reunion is coming to an end. Their final show will be at New York's Madison Square Garden.

The last ever show from The Police will be a benefit show to raise funds for New York Public Television.

"We are honored to partner with public television and have a deep respect for their commitment to arts and culture," said The Police at a May 6th press conference.

The band also announced their own pledge to the city of $1 million towards the Mayor's MillionTrees initiative to plant 10,000 new trees and help reforest 2,000 acres of New York City.

To raise the money, a number of special souvenir options are in play for the show. For $5000, you can go to the sound-check and attend a dinner prior to special seating at the show.

For $2000, you will receive prime seating and a pre-show reception.

The remainder of the tickets are $750, $500, $350 and $150.

The support act for the show will be B52's.

The last ever Police show will take place at Madison Square Garden on August 7.
